Sims Lifecycle Services (SLS) is a world-wide leader in IT asset and cloud infrastructure reuse, redeployment, recycling and refining.  SLS serves global clients across a range of industries to securely and responsibly recycle and manage the disposition of IT equipment and electronic products.
Our asset management and recovery service enables businesses to meet both their social and legal obligations in the treatment of surplus electronics in a legally compliant, data secure, fully traceable, and environmentally sustainable manner. With our global reach, expertise, and infrastructure, SLS is able to provide a comprehensive solution for e-waste and IT asset disposition anywhere in the world.

Reporting to our Accounts Payable Supervisor, this role will be a detail-oriented finance professional responsible for managing a company’s outgoing payments. They ensure that invoices are accurately processed, approved, and paid on time while maintaining organized financial records. Key duties include verifying invoices, reconciling accounts, processing payments, and communicating with vendors to resolve discrepancies. By maintaining accuracy and efficiency, Accounts Payable Clerks play a critical role in supporting smooth financial operations and maintaining strong supplier relationships.

Key Accountabilities:

• Review and validate vendor invoices to ensure accuracy and completeness of all supporting documentation
• Confirm proper approval and correct coding on all submitted invoices
• Detect and escalate duplicate invoices, irregular transactions, or any discrepancies
• Match invoices against purchase orders and receiving documentation for verification
• Prepare EFT payment documentation using Adobe Acrobat
• Verify receipt of goods or services in alignment with purchase orders
• Address vendor inquiries and resolve billing discrepancies in a timely manner
• Work cross-functionally with operations, logistics, procurement, and finance teams to investigate and resolve invoice issues and ensure prompt processing
• Process freight invoices using SLS’s Vadis and Makor systems to extract and validate required data
• Provide support to the Accounting Department with additional administrative tasks as needed
• Assist with month-end close activities, including accruals, invoice cutoff reviews, and reconciliation preparation
• Perform other duties and participate in special projects as assigned
Experience/Qualifications Required:
• Minimum of 2 years of experience in Accounts Payable processing
• Experience working with large ERP systems, with preference for Microsoft Dynamics Navision
• Familiarity with purchase order processes and invoice matching
• Strong organizational and time management sk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ines
•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ive financial data with discretion
• Experience in a high-volume invoice processing environment is preferred
